About Palmerston North and Palmy Weather

Welcome to Palmerston North - "The heart of the Manawatū".
This Palmerston North weather station is located just west of the city centre with data updated every 10 seconds. The hardware used is part of the Ecowitt weather station framework in conjunction with CumulusMX software. Starting in January 2009, Palmy Weather has been gathering weather data for over 17 years, providing a valuable and accessible resource to the community of Palmerston North and the wider Manawatū.

About This City: Palmerston North, affectionately known as Palmy, is an inland city located on the west coast of New Zealand's North Island. It is the largest city in the Manawatū-Wanganui district and the the business hub for this region with a population of 84,639 according to the 2018 census. Palmerston North's climate is temperate with maximum day temperatures averaging 22°C (72°F) in summer and 12°C (54°F) in winter. Annual rainfall is approximately 960mm (37.8in).
